Job Description

The Senior Director, General Manager (GM) Development serves as the enterprise leader and architect of Marriott’s global General Manager Development strategy. This role is accountable for defining, governing, and continuously evolving a comprehensive, end-to-end GM Development Ecosystem—spanning onboarding, acceleration, continuous development, readiness, and succession—serving all General Managers across brands, service models, and geographies.
